The Big Leap ... jelly roll sew along by Doreen Johnson 2016©
Instructions for the 82" x 82" Triple Chain Quilt top
Cut (3) 10.5" x wof strips.
Cut (8) 6.5" x wof strips. Set these aside for the outer borders.
Cut (32) 2.5" x wof strips.
For Set A:
Count out 21 of the 2.5" x wof background strips. Cut each strip in half on the fold
(the 2.5" side) to yield a total of (42) 2.5" x 21 or 22" strips.
Remove 1 strip and place the remaining 41 half strips in a pile for Set A.
For Set B:
Subcut the 10.5" x wof strips into (12) 10.5" squares.
Count out (3) of the 2.5" x wof strips - cut each in half on the fold to yield
a total of (6) 2.5" x 21 or 22" strips.
Subcut the remaining (8) 2.5" x wof strips into (48) 2.5" x 6.5" strips.
Jelly Roll fabrics
For Set A:
Count out 22 Jelly roll strips (2.5" x wof) Cut each strip in half on fold to yield
a total of (44) 2.5" x 21 or 22" strips.
Remove 1 of the half strips and place the remaining 43 half strips
with the background fabrics you cut for Set A.
For Set B:
Count out 6 Jelly roll strips (2.5" x wof) - cut each strip in half on fold to yield
a total of (12) 2.5" x 21 or 22" strips.
Place 6 of the half strips with the background fabrics you cut for Set B.
Cut the remaining 6 half strips into (48) 2.5" squares.
Save the remaining 2.5" x wof strips you have left over from your Jelly Roll bundle.
You can use some of these to make a scrappy binding for your quilt
